Document Description
This project will increase pedestrian safety and access by providing curb extensions, raised crosswalks, new crosswalks, HAWK signal, Rectangular Rapid Flashing Beacon, ADA compliant curb ramps, Leading Pedestrian Intervals, accessible Pedestrian Signals, speed humps, speed feedback signs, and continental crosswalks.

Notice of Exemption

Exempt Status
Categorical Exemption
Type, Section or Code
CEQA Article III, Class 1, Section 3
Reasons for Exemption
consists of hte operation, repair, maintenance or minor alteration to existing highways and streets, sidewalks, gutters, involving negligible or no expansion of use beyond that previously existing. The project includes minor public alterations of land, including curb extensions, continental crosswalk installation, and signal installations. There will be no expansion of use and no removal of a scenic resource. None of the limitations set forth in State CEQA Guidelines 15300.2 apply.
